Les Dennis
Les Dennis has been one of Britain's most popular entertainers over the last 30 years. His voice is instantly recognisable with a vast array of characters, voices and impressions.
Les is to star in 'Drowning on Dry Land' by Alan Ayckbourn at The Jermyn Street Theatre
His autobiography, 'Must the Show Go On?', is one of the most extraordinary and searingly honest memoirs you will read.
He made his TV breakthrough on Russ Abbot's Madhouse, before having a hugely successful run as the host of The Laughter Show and Family Fortunes. More recently he has been appearing in more serious dramas, and he made an unforgettable appearance in Extras with Ricky Gervais.
